Ingredients & Substitutions
The beauty of this Easy Thai Chicken Soup lies in its flexibility. Use fresh or pantry staples—it’ll still shine! Here’s what you’ll need:
| Ingredient | Role | Possible Substitutions |
|---|---|---|
| Chicken breast | Protein base | Thighs, tofu, or shrimp |
| Coconut milk | Creaminess | Light coconut milk or cashew cream |
| Lemongrass | Bright, citrusy flavor | 1 tbsp lemon zest + 1 tsp ginger |
| Red curry paste | Spice & depth | Yellow curry paste or sriracha |
| Fish sauce | Umami kick | Soy sauce or coconut aminos |
| Veggies (bell peppers, mushrooms) | Texture & nutrients | Zucchini, spinach, or snap peas |

Step-by-Step Instructions
Let’s make this Easy Thai Chicken Soup! Follow these simple steps for a flawless pot:
1. Sauté aromatics: Heat 1 tbsp oil in a pot. Add minced garlic, ginger, and lemongrass. Cook until fragrant (1–2 minutes).
2. Add curry paste: Stir in 2 tbsp red curry paste, coating the aromatics.
3. Pour liquids: Add 4 cups chicken broth and 1 can coconut milk. Bring to a gentle simmer.
4. Cook chicken: Add 1 lb diced chicken breast. Simmer 10–12 minutes until cooked through.
5. Veggies & finish: Toss in sliced bell peppers and mushrooms. Cook 5 more minutes. Off heat, mix in 1 tbsp fish sauce and lime juice.
This Winter Soup Recipes star is ready in 30 minutes! Top with cilantro, basil, or crushed peanuts.

Troubleshooting & Pro Tips
– Too spicy? Balance with extra coconut milk or a drizzle of honey.
– Too thin? Simmer longer or add ¼ cup rice to thicken.
– Pro tip: For deeper flavor, char the lemongrass lightly before adding.
– Shortcut: Use rotisserie chicken! Add it in step 5 to warm through.
Storage & Make-Ahead Tips
This soup tastes even better the next day! Store in an airtight container for up to 4 days or freeze for 3 months. To reheat, warm gently on the stove with a splash of broth. For meal prep, chop veggies and chicken ahead—then assemble when ready.

FAQ
1. Can I make this vegetarian?
Absolutely! Swap chicken for tofu or chickpeas and use veggie broth.
2. Is coconut milk essential?
Yes for authenticity, but light coconut milk works. Avoid dairy—it’ll curdle.
3. How do I store leftovers?
Refrigerate up to 4 days. Freeze without fresh herbs for best texture.
